java如何输出一整个数组

java如何输出一整个数组

作者:Joshua Lee发布时间:2026-02-12阅读时长:0 分钟阅读次数:4

用户关注问题

Q
如何在Java中打印数组的所有元素?

我想在Java程序里输出一个数组的所有内容,应该用哪种方法比较方便?

A

使用Arrays.toString方法打印数组

在Java中,可以使用java.util.Arrays类的toString方法来输出一维数组的所有元素。只需调用Arrays.toString(数组名),即可快速获得数组内容的字符串表示并打印出来。

Q
Java中如何输出多维数组的完整内容?

如果我有一个二维或多维数组,怎样才能一次性打印出里面所有的元素?

A

利用Arrays.deepToString方法输出多维数组

对于多维数组,Arrays类提供了deepToString方法,它能递归地将多维数组转换为字符串。调用Arrays.deepToString(多维数组名)后,能直接打印出多维数组中的所有元素。

Q
有没有其他方法在Java中输出数组内容?

除了使用Arrays类的方法,Java中还有哪些方式可以将数组内容输出到控制台?

A

通过循环遍历数组输出每个元素

可以使用for循环或增强型for循环遍历数组中的每个元素,然后逐个打印。这样既适用于一维数组,也能根据需要手动实现多维数组的输出格式,灵活性较高。